This is the legend of The Wendigo of the North Woods of Minnesota. When winter gnaws
the bones of the earth, the Wendigo walks. Born from hunger, it wears a man’s
face stretched over a skull that’s not quite human. Hunters say its cry sounds like
someone you love calling for help. If you answer, you feed it. Tracks lead nowhere.
Fires die without wind. A trapper once found meat smoking in the snow.
When he turned it over, it was his own hand. He ran until spring. They found him smiling,
frozen, eyes wide with something that wasn’t madness—it was memory. The Wendigo doesn’t
